Homowo ban on noisemaking begins Aug 8

August 7, 2016
Reading Time: 1 min read
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

The La Dadekotopon Municipal Assembly has placed a traditional ban on noise making in some key areas ahead of this year’s celebration of Homowo in the La Paramount area.

The ban which takes effect from Monday, August 8, 2016 to September 2 will be effective between the hours of 4pm to 6pm every day.

The affected areas include, Shiashie, Bawaleshi, Okponglo,Mpehuasem, Ogbojo, Ashalley Botwe,Agbogba, Nkwantana Atiman, Adentan, Teiman.

Also affected are Abotsiman, Frafraha, Amanfro, Ashieyie, Maala Jorn, Oyarifa Amrahia and Ayi Mensah.

In view of this, the La Dadekotopon Municipal Assembly has asked all churches, hotels, eateries and other business entities to take note and comply accordingly

They say that the ban on noise making is to allow for a peaceful La Homowo.
